    Abstract: A backlight module and a display device are disclosed. The backlight module includes a back plate, an assembled light plate composed of multiple light plates, and a pressure bar. The assembled light plate is fixed to the back plate by the pressure bar. The pressure bar includes a fixing portion and a connecting portion. One end of the connecting portion goes through the gap, and the other end is connected to the fixing portion. The fixing portion extends from the gap to the light plates on both sides to form a first abutting portion and a second abutting portion. The surfaces of the first and the second abutting portions adjacent to the light plates are level and flush with each other. The first and the second abutting portions respectively abut and firmly press the light-emitting surfaces of the light plates on both sides. The fixed portion covers the entire gap.

    Abstract: An array substrate, a manufacturing method thereof, and a display device are provided. The array substrate includes a display area and a non-display area in which a peripheral circuit is provided. The peripheral circuit includes a test area, a bonding area, and a cutting area. The test area is provided with a test signal line for providing a test signal. The bonding area is adjacent to the display area, and the bonding area and the test area are electrically connected through signal leads. The cutting area is disposed between the test area and the bonding area. After a cutting process is completed in the cutting area, a cutting opening is formed on each signal lead. A position of the cutting opening of at least one signal lead is different from positions of the cutting openings of other signal leads in height along an extending direction of the signal leads.

    Abstract: A pixel driving circuit and a display panel are provided. The pixel driving circuit, including a first-color subpixel, a second-color subpixel, and a third-color subpixel, is configured to drive a pixel unit. The pixel driving circuit includes a first driving unit, a second driving unit, and a third driving unit. The first driving unit is configured to drive according to a first voltage signal the first-color subpixel. The second driving unit is configured to drive according to the first voltage signal the second-color subpixel. The third driving unit is configured to drive according to the first voltage signal the third-color subpixel. The first driving unit at least includes a first capacitor, the second driving unit at least includes a second capacitor, the third driving unit at least includes a third capacitor, and at least one of the first capacitor, the second capacitor, and the third capacitor has a different capacitance.

    Abstract: The present application discloses a array substrate, a manufacturing method of the array substrate, and a display panel, the manufacture procedure includes the following steps: sequentially forming a buffer layer and a photoresist layer on a glass substrate; placing the substrate into an activation agent for activation, and forming an activation liquid particle layer with a first preset pattern at a corresponding position where the activation agent is in contact with the photoresist layer, and forming an activation liquid particle layer with a second preset pattern at a corresponding position where the activation agent is in contact with the buffer layer; removing the photoresist layer and the activation liquid particle layer with the first preset pattern; and performing chemical plating to form a first metal layer at a position corresponding to the activation liquid particle layer with the second preset pattern in contact with the buffer layer.

    Abstract: A display panel and a display device are provided. The display panel includes multiple sub-panels. The sub-panel includes a first substrate, a first signal-transmission layer disposed on the first substrate, and a light-emitting layer disposed at the first substrate and electrically coupled with the first signal-transmission layer. The display panel further includes a second substrate, a second signal-transmission layer disposed on the second substrate, and multiple conductive transfer members. The second substrate is disposed in correspondence with the multiple sub-panels and disposed opposite to and spaced apart from the first substrate. The multiple of conductive transfer members are disposed at the first substrate, where each conductive transfer member is electrically coupled with the first signal-transmission layer and the second signal-transmission layer.

    Abstract: Disclosed are a method and a device for repairing a circuit on an array substrate, and an array substrate. The method includes: determining a section to be repaired on each signal line; applying a conductive material to form a repair line between two ends of the section to be repaired, the repair line being connected with two ends of the section to be repaired; and applying an insulating material to form a cover layer above the repair line, the cover layer completely covers the surface of the repair line.

    Abstract: The present application discloses a cutting method for a display panel, a display panel and a display device, the cutting method for a display panel including a cutting stage of a side edge of a binding area and a cutting stage of a side edge of a non-binding area, the cutting stage of a side edge of a non-binding area includes steps of: aligning a cutter according to an alignment mark preset on the side edge of the non-binding area on the display panel, so that a cutter on a second substrate side is closer to a display area of the display panel than a cutter on a first substrate side, and cutting the first substrate and the second substrate by the cutter on the second substrate side and the cutter on the first substrate side respectively.

    Abstract: A display panel and a display device including the display panel are disclosed. The display panel includes an array substrate, a color film substrate, and a liquid crystal layer and a first spacer both between the array substrate and the color film substrate. Assembly surfaces of the color film substrate and the array substrate are oppositely assembled. An edge of the assembly surface of the color film substrate is provided with an edge shielding area. An edge of the assembly surface of the array substrate is provided with a component located in a projection of the edge shielding area on the array substrate. The first spacer is located in the edge shielding area and outside the projection of the component on the edge shielding area. The first spacer supports the edge shielding area and an area of the array substrate corresponding to the edge shielding area.

    Abstract: Disclosed are a method and a device for monitoring downtime of a target machine, and a computer readable storage medium. The method includes the following operations: receiving operating state information of the target machine in real time; determining whether the target machine is down according to the operating state information; and sending downtime prompt information to a mobile terminal account of a person responsible for the target machine when the target machine is down.

    Abstract: The present application discloses a gate driver circuit of a display panel, a driving method therefor and a display circuit. The gate driver circuit of a display panel includes a multi-stage cascaded shift register, where an any-stage shift register includes: a charging circuit, a pull-down circuit for controlling to pull down a potential of an output terminal of the charging circuit to a low level in a non-scanning time, and an output control circuit electrically coupled to the output terminal of the charging circuit for receiving an initial gate scanning signal; the output control circuit is connected to an enable signal and controls the output of the gate scanning signal according to the enable signal.
